EA Commentary: The Boondock Saints

For the latest Everything Actioncast, Zach and Chris celebrate St. Patrick’s Day with the most whiskey soaked action movie of all time, The Boondock Saints.

Starring a then basically unknown Norman Reedus and Sean Patrick Flanery, who was probably best known for the Young Indiana Jones TV series, The Boondock Saints features the pair as the McManus Brothers, who kind of just stumble into a career as vigilantes determined to clean up the crime flooding the streets of Boston and start to systematically take out various mob goons with the help of their buddy Rocco (David Della Rocco).  The brother’s activity is investigated by flamboyantly over the top FBI Agent Smecker (Willem Dafoe) and a legendary hitman named Il Duce (Billy Connelly) also eventually gets into the mix.

The movie is available to stream on Amazon Prime and you can watch along with the guys as they remember how many abrupt edits and flashbacks there are in the movie, the bizarre sight of former TGIF star Billy Connelly as the most dangerous man in the world, Willem Dafoe practicing the bug-eyed insanity he would bring soon to Spider-Man, the various “influences” on the movie and much more.
